JOB PURPOSE:
The Portfolio Analytics team is responsible for the production of investment performance reporting packages for high net worth and institutional clients. The team also ensures the accuracy of performance calculations and related data.
Assistant Vice President
Prepare standard and ad-hoc investment performance reports for team's stakeholders (senior management, portfolio managers, marketing, and relationship managers), ensuring accuracy and completeness of data.
Calculate, reconcile, analyze, and update investment performance information across various applications.
Respond to inquiries about investment performance methodology and reporting.
Troubleshoot and correct inaccurate data in a timely manner.
Ensure deliverables are met, timely and accurately, while following procedures and policies
Assist in GIPS compliance and required documentation.
Ownership of data quality and availability.
Work independently on a variety of analytical projects, but also provide support to other Portfolio Analytics team members as needed.

Solid understanding of the investment management industry, specifically equity and fixed income markets as well as industry benchmarks.
Prior experience with performance reporting systems, accounting systems and analytic systems are a plus (FirstRate, FactSet PA, FactSet SPAR, Investedge, FIS Global Plus, Advent Axys, Bloomberg)
Proficiency in MS Office (Excel, PowerPoint, Word, Outlook), with advanced skills in Excel
Knowledge of Global Investment Performance Standards (GIPS)
Strong project management skills including the ability to handle multiple deadlines, work under pressure, identify operational requirements and interface cross-functionally.
Strong communication skills are a must.
Experience working with SQL, Python, VBA is a plus.
Assistant Vice President
2-3 years of experience in investment performance reporting and accounting
CFA, CAIA or CIPM, or progress towards a designation is preferred.
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ting or Economics preferred or commensurate work-related experience.
